Official abstract text for this publication.
A balance wheel including a rim connected to a hub with at least one arm, wherein the balance wheel includes an adjustable auxiliary temperature compensation system mounted in the space defined by the rim to allow adjustable temperature compensation of the balance wheel.

What is claimed is: 1. A balance wheel comprising a rim connected to a hub with at least one arm, the balance wheel comprising an adjustable auxiliary temperature compensation system mounted in the space defined by the rim, the adjustable auxiliary temperature compensation system being configured to adjust the temperature compensation of the balance wheel, the temperature compensation system comprising: a bimetallic strip device comprising at least one first strip and at least one second strip, said at least one first and at least one second strips each having different expansion coefficients and are arranged such that they are attached on top of one another to ensure that the curvature of the bimetallic strip device varies as a function of temperature, the bimetallic strip device extending between a first end and a second end; a fixing device forming an integral part of the first end of the bimetallic strip device, the fixing device comprising adjustable orientation means configured to change the orientation of the compensation system with respect to said at least one arm of the balance wheel, a block forming an integral part of the second end of the bimetallic strip device. 2. The balance wheel according to claim 1 , wherein the adjustable auxiliary temperature compensation system is mounted on said at least one arm of the balance wheel. 3. The balance wheel according to claim 1 , wherein the adjustable auxiliary temperature compensation system is mounted on the hub of the balance wheel. 4. The balance wheel according to claim 1 , wherein the adjustable auxiliary temperature compensation system is mounted on the rim of the balance wheel. 5. The balance wheel according to claim 1 , wherein the fixing device comprises adjustable positioning means between the hub and the rim so as to adjust the influence of the adjustable auxiliary temperature compensation system, the adjustable positioning means being arranged to modify the radial distance between the hub and the first end of the bimetallic strip device. 6. The balance wheel according to claim 5 , wherein the adjustable positioning means comprise a radial recess so as to select a position between the hub and the rim. 7. The balance wheel according to claim 1 , wherein said at least one first strip is based on silicon. 8. The balance wheel according to claim 1 , wherein said at least one second strip is based on metal. 9. The balance wheel according to claim 1 , wherein the bimetallic strip device forms a curved band under ambient temperature and pressure conditions. 10. The balance wheel according to claim 1 , wherein the block forms an integral part of one of the ends of said at least one first and at least one second strips to increase the influence of the adjustable auxiliary temperature compensation system. 11. The balance wheel according to claim 1 , wherein the adjustable auxiliary temperature compensation system also comprises a counterweight to compensate for the weight of the bimetallic strip device. 12. The balance wheel according to claim 1 , wherein the balance wheel comprises a plurality of adjustable auxiliary temperature compensation systems. 13. The balance wheel according to claim 1 , wherein the block extends in a curve secant to the bimetallic strip device. 14. The balance wheel according to claim 1 , wherein the block comprises two projecting parts either side of the bimetallic strip device. 15. A resonator comprising a compensating balance spring, wherein the compensating balance spring is connected to a balance wheel according to claim 1 .
